PLVE DENTIST REQUIRED IN IPSWICH - SPONSORSHIP PROVIDED
- Full time work ideally; Starting ASAP
- Working hours: 9am-5pm Monday-Friday
- 3000+ UDA's available depending on number of days worked
- Offering £14-£15 per UDA
- Private remuneration at 47%, lab bills split at 50%
- Established list of patients to take over from
- Offering PLVE opportunity and sponsorship if required
Practice information:
- Mixed practice with 4 surgeries
- Exact software on site
- Acteon PSPIXX2 Digital Xrays, Acteon CBCT & CS3800 i/o wireless scanner
- Paid parking available close by or on request the practice can arrange subsidised parking
- Ipswich train station is 15-17 minutes walk from the practice
- They do several private campaigns to enhance the private income
